About Indiana Wesleyan University at University Heights United Methodist

Indiana Wesleyan University at University Heights United Methodist is an instructional site located in Indianapolis, Indiana. This location represents a partnership between Indiana Wesleyan University and the University Heights United Methodist Church, through which the university delivers postsecondary coursework at the church's facilities.

Specific postsecondary program offerings are not currently listed in available data. Indiana Wesleyan University, a private Christian liberal arts university based in Marion, Indiana, offers programs in business, education, nursing, and ministry through its main campus and various regional learning sites.

Indianapolis is Indiana's capital and largest city. Extension sites within Indianapolis allow Indiana Wesleyan University to serve working adult students and other learners who benefit from completing coursework at convenient locations within the metropolitan area.

About Indiana Trade Education

Indiana has 1,556 trade schools and 476 vocational programs, with 1,386 apprenticeship sponsors statewide. The state's high apprenticeship sponsor count relative to its program count indicates a strong emphasis on on-the-job training pathways alongside classroom-based instruction. Indianapolis leads with 220 schools, followed by Fort Wayne with 84, Evansville with 44, Lafayette with 41, and Terre Haute with 35.
